Five major regattas ear-marked for rowers this year
Rowing: Oarsmen and Oarswomen are in luck's way. Two rowers have been
invited to train in Beijing, China - Venue for 2008. Olympics from April
this year by the International Governing Body for rowing (FISA). The
Lankan rowers will also be involved in five major rowing championships
for the year 2008, two foreign regattas in Singapore and India -
(Chennai) and three championships here.
Deva Henry, the President of the Amateur Rowing Association of Sri
Lanka (ARASL) said that in addition to training in Beijing and five
major international championship meets, Sri Lanka will also concentrate
on domestic events.
FISA has offered the opportunity for two rowers (male/female) to
train in Beijing due to the recognition received by ARASL. 'Our aim is
to row at the Manchester. London, Olympic Games to be held in 2012. The
two rowers will train in Beijing and FISA will arrange further training
programs alternatively in different countries." said Henry.
The two rowers have been selected and have to be approved by the
Sports Ministry. Lakmal Wickremage, National coach will accompany the
two rowers.
The championships at which our rowers will participate are Asian
Junior Rowing Championships in Singapore in June, the Prestigious
Colombo-Madras Regatta in Chennai in July, AREA Regatta in Colombo in
August, Invitation Regatta in Colombo (date not finalised) and Asian
Senior Regatta in Colombo in December. |
